Modified sine wave output is specifically incompatible with the active power factor correction (APFC) circuitry found in the vast majority of desktop PC power supplies built in the last decade, running APFC equipment on a modified sine wave UPS during an outage can cause audible buzzing, overheating, reduced efficiency, or unexpected shutdown mid-outage, the exact scenario the UPS exists to prevent.
That said, pure sine wave isn't a universal upgrade every setup needs, simple electronics without APFC and basic network gear generally run fine on modified sine wave, and pure sine wave units command a real 30-50% price premium worth weighing against what's actually plugged in.
4 Criteria to Look For Before Buying a Pure Sine Wave UPS Battery Backup
Key buying criteria so you get the right fit the first time.
APFC compatibility is the real reason to buy pure sine wave
The vast majority of modern desktop PC power supplies use active power factor correction circuitry that specifically requires pure sine wave input, running them on modified sine wave can cause buzzing, overheating, or shutdown.
Pure sine wave isn't a universal upgrade every setup needs
Basic network equipment and simple electronics without APFC generally run fine on modified sine wave, the 30-50% price premium for pure sine wave should be weighed against what's actually plugged in.
Efficiency and runtime can differ slightly from modified sine wave designs
Pure sine wave inverter designs are sometimes marginally less efficient than simpler modified sine wave designs at the same VA rating, a nuance worth checking if runtime is a priority.
Buzzing or unexpected shutdown on an existing UPS often signals a waveform mismatch
If your current UPS causes buzzing or shuts down connected equipment unexpectedly on battery power, the root cause is very likely modified-sine-to-APFC incompatibility, not a defective unit.

How to Choose the Right Pure Sine Wave UPS Battery Backups
Why Modified Sine Wave Can Actually Damage Modern PCs
Modified sine wave output is specifically incompatible with the active power factor correction (APFC) circuitry in most desktop PC power supplies built in the last decade. Running APFC equipment on modified sine wave during an outage can cause audible buzzing, overheating, reduced efficiency, or unexpected shutdown, the exact failure the UPS exists to prevent. If you're unsure whether your PC has an APFC power supply, assume it does, it's now the desktop standard.

Symptom Diagnosis: Buzzing or Unexpected Shutdown on Battery
If your existing UPS causes audible buzzing, overheating, or unexpected shutdown when running on battery power, this is very likely a modified-sine-wave-to-APFC incompatibility, not a failing UPS. Upgrading to a pure sine wave model like the picks in this guide resolves the issue directly.
Frequently Asked Questions
Do I really need a pure sine wave UPS for my PC?
If your PC has an active power factor correction (APFC) power supply, which is standard on the vast majority of desktops built in the last decade, yes. Modified sine wave can cause buzzing, overheating, or unexpected shutdown on APFC hardware.
Why does my current UPS buzz or shut my PC down when running on battery?
This is a very common symptom of modified sine wave output being incompatible with an APFC power supply, not a defective UPS. Upgrading to a genuine pure sine wave model resolves it.
Is pure sine wave worth the extra cost for basic electronics?
Not necessarily. Simple network equipment and basic electronics without APFC power supplies generally run fine on modified sine wave, save the 30-50% premium for equipment that actually needs it.
Does pure sine wave affect UPS battery runtime?
Sometimes marginally. Pure sine wave inverter designs can be slightly less efficient than simpler modified sine wave designs at the same VA rating, though the difference is usually small in practice.
